What does an underwriter manager do?

An Underwriter Manager oversees a team of underwriters who evaluate and assess the risk of insuring clients or approving loans. They are responsible for ensuring that underwriting guidelines and compliance standards are met, reviewing complex cases, and making final decisions on high-value or high-risk applications. Additionally, they train and mentor staff, implement process improvements, and collaborate with other departments to optimize risk management strategies. Their role is vital in maintaining profitability and minimizing losses for the organ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an underwriter manager?

To thrive as an Underwriter Manager, you need a strong background in risk assessment, underwriting policies, and financial analysis,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in finance, business, or a related field. Expertise with underwriting software, risk management platforms, and familiarity with industry certifications such as CPCU or ARM are commonly expected. Leadership, decision-making, and effective communication skills set top performers apart by enabling them to guide teams and negotiate with stakeholders. These skills ensure sound risk evaluation, regulatory compliance, and efficient team management, which are critical for organizational profitability and growth.

What are some common challenges faced by underwriter managers when overseeing a team of underwriters?

Underwriter Managers often face challenges such as balancing workload distribution among team members, ensuring consistent application of underwriting guidelines, and keeping up with regulatory changes. They must also mentor junior underwriters, handle escalated cases, and foster collaboration between underwriting, sales, and compliance departments. Effective communication and adaptability are key, as Underwriter Managers need to support team development while meeting organizational targets and maintaining risk standards.

What is the difference between Underwriter Manager vs Underwriter?

AspectUnderwriter ManagerUnderwriter
ResponsibilitiesOversees underwriting teams, develops policies, manages risk assessment strategiesPerforms individual risk assessments, approves or rejects insurance applications
CredentialsTypically requires a relevant insurance or finance certification, experience in underwritingRequires similar certifications, often with less managerial experience
Work EnvironmentManagement meetings, team supervision, strategic planningAnalyzing applications, assessing risks, making underwriting decisions
Industry UsageCommon in insurance companies, financial institutionsWidespread across insurance, reinsurance, and financial sectors

The main difference between an Underwriter Manager and an Underwriter is that the manager oversees the underwriting team and strategic processes, while the underwriter focuses on individual risk assessment and decision-making. Both roles require similar credentials, but the manager has additional leadership responsibilities.

Job Description
Senior Underwriter
Location: Woodbridge, VA
OR
*****WILL CONSIDER REMOTE ACCESS FOR EXPERIENCED CANDIDATES***
This Senior Underwriter is responsible for the following:
• Responsible for reviewing initial underwriting files and reviewing final conditions
• Must have ability to underwrite 4-5 loans a day or 100 loans a month on average
• Must meet company established goals for turn times on initial and condition review
• Must have very extensive knowledge of all loan programs
• Ability to underwrite without supervision
• Consistently out performs lower level underwriting team members
• Assists Underwriting Manager with training lower level team members
• Must maintain not only speed, but accuracy in all areas of underwriting
• Responds in a timely manner to any QC, Investor or GSE deficiency
Qualifications
• Underwriter will have at least 10 years+ of underwriting experience or equivalent.
Must have certification to underwrite FHA, VA and/or USDA, and Conventional Loans.
Must be DE Certified.
• This level requires minimal supervision.
• Must be a Team Player and work closely with the sales team to ensure every option available is made to find best loan programs available for a borrower.
